Our School is going wireless, so that the pupils can use wireless
laptops in any classroom and connect to our ADSL router etc

We aim to install several Wireless Access Points around the school,
should they all be set to the same channel e.g. Ch 6 - or should each
Access Point have a different channel?

Use the same SSID system wide but run each access point on a different
channel. Channels 1, 6 and 11 have the least overlap.

Al - thanks for the prompt reply, but what is the reasoning behind using
different channels on each Access Point?

that minimizes rf interferance between the access points where they overlap
coverage. and the clients will search all the frequencies for the access
points anyway.
